Sample Introduction

Everyone has something that makes them important. Everyone is different, and that’s okay. In the film, Finding Nemo, there are many things that make each character unique. Disney’s Pixar teaches that it is important to celebrate what makes you different.

yellow= hook and background

Purple= bridge

White= thesis

Body Paragraph

Assertion to support thesis: Not the textual evidence, but the topic of evidence-see last slide for examples

Transition-Set up what is happening the story for the evidence you’re about to present

Textual Evidence- If you have the story, it’s a word for word quote

If you are using a film, then paraphrase what happens in the movie

Page 7: Writing to Inform. Write your theme! Possible Theme! It is important to celebrate what makes you different!

Body Paragraph cont.

Interpretation: Restate the evidence in a new way

Justification: Prove how/why your evidence connects to and proves your assertion and thesis.

Sample Body Paragraph #1

The movie features sharks with unique tastes. While Marlin is trying to find Nemo, he and Dory meet some unusual sharks. The sharks are unusual because they claim, “Fish are friends, not food!” (Finding Nemo). Marlin and Dory meet Bruce, Chum, and Anchor; three sharks who don’t eat fish. These sharks celebrate being different by supporting each other in their alternative lifestyle. They hold meetings to keep each other accountable to not eat fish. Also, Chum and Anchor try to intervene when Bruce smells Dory’s blood. At the end of the film, you see Dory and the sharks are still friends. The sharks differences allow them to create friendships with fish. These sharks are different and they are some of the best characters. They show being different is something to aspire to.
